Aluminum Metal Matrix driveshafts are indeed available, just not from Dynotech. They cost more, but you can get it in both 3.5" and 4". They don't have an off-the-shelf replacement, and you have to change yokes to use a 1350 u-joint. It's the Accu-bond from Mark Williams.
